I thought I'd share my experiences of Bass Pro Shop at rancho kookamunga, about an hour and a half from downtown LA. This place is three stories of fishing, camping, hunting and ourdoor gear. According to the website its 180,000 square feet - it was literally the size of footy park.Has a restaurant connected to it, which is apparently all right. But who'd eat there, I'd be spending my dollars on the gear inside!SAFWAA worldwide!Front entranceMore rods/reels/lines, everything you can think of than you could poke a stick at.Also has an outdoors section, along with a marine bit that does boat sales What I found most impressive was the display inside. A manikin, decked out in fly gear - standing in a running stream, full of browns and rainbows. Some of these fish were around the 24" mark ! Would've killed to drop something in there....
